We wish to invite you to the third national conference on Effective
Transition in Adult Education that will take place on November 16 - 17,
2009, at the Crowne Plaza Hotel in Providence, RI.
The conference is sponsored by the National College Transition Network at
World Education in partnership with the Nellie Mae Education Foundation. The
two-day conference will focus on strategies and promising practices that
help adult learners succeed in postsecondary education and training.
